Heated Seat Always On

Step Action Yes No
Schematic Reference: Driver Seat Schematics , Passenger Seat Schematics
Connector End View Reference: Power Seat Connector End Views
1 Did you perform the Diagnostic System Check - Vehicle? Go to Step 2  Go to Diagnostic System Check - Vehicle
2 Operate the heated seat system.
Does the system operate normally?
Go to Testing for Intermittent Conditions and Poor Connections Go to Step 3 
3
  1. Install a scan tool.
  2. Display the Heated Seat Status parameter in the Driver Seat Module Input/Output Data List.
  3. Start the engine.
Does the scan tool display the Heated Seat Status parameter as Off?
Go to Step 6  Go to Step 4 
4 Display the Heated Seat Mode parameter in the Door Module Inputs Data List.
Does the scan tool display the Heated Seat Mode parameter as Off?
Go to Step 6  Go to Step 5 
5
  1. Turn OFF the ignition.
  2. Disconnect the heated seat switch connector to the door module.
  3. Start the engine.
Does the scan tool display the Heated Seat Mode parameter as Off?
Go to Step 7  Go to Step 8 
6 Replace the driver seat module. Refer to Control Module References for replacement, setup and programming.
Is the repair complete?
Go to Step 9  -
7 Replace the heated seat switch. Refer to Heated Seat Switch Replacement - Front .
Is the repair complete?
Go to Step 9  -
8 Replace the door module. Refer to Control Module References .
Is the repair complete?
Go to Step 9  -
9 Operate the system in order to verify the repair.
Did you correct the condition?
System OK Go to Step 3
